Zach grew up in Springfield, Illinois, and is a 1997 graduate of Springfield High School. He earned his B.S. in Biological Sciences from Notre Dame in 2001. In 2006, he received his Ph.D. in Molecular Cancer Biology from Duke University in the laboratory of Dr. Sally Kornbluth. He then joined Dr. Joan Brugge’s laboratory in the Department of Cell Biology at Harvard Medical School as a postdoctoral fellow. In 2009, he returned to Notre Dame to join the faculty in the Department of Biological Sciences. He is currently the Coleman Foundation Associate Professor of Cancer Biology. Jianping He, Ph.D.
Senior Scientist

Jianping earned his B.S. and Ph.D. from Xiamen University where he conducted research on nuclear receptors and selective autophagy in Qiao Wu’s laboratory. He then moved to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ory to work with Dr. Linda Van Aelst on organ specific metastasis as a postdoctoral fellow. Jianping joined the Schafer Lab as a postdoctoral fellow in 2019 and in 2023 was promoted to senior scientist.

James (Jamie) is from Yardley, Pennsylvania and got his Bachelor's Degree in Biology from the University of Maryland, College Park. Following his time at UMD he worked at Johns Hopkins as a research technologist working on iPSC differentiation factors and was able to travel to South Korea to conduct research there through an exchange program. He began in the Schafer Lab in 2018 and is investigating metabolic rewiring within cancer cells which promotes resistance to immunotherapy.
